> .... Do some types of seed keep better than others?
>

Yes!  Germination rates decline, but depending on how rare or hard to
come by the seed is, it may be worth keeping some of them.

Tomato seeds, for instance, are generally thought of as lasting 4
years, but with care can be revived after 10 years, and I think the
record is 50 years.
